Opplysninger | Description based upon print version of record.. - Cover; Contents; List of Figures; Introduction; 1 Pre-trial Procedure; 2 Trial Procedure; 3 Circumstantial Evidence; 4 Ritual Acts and Artefacts of Witchcraft; 5 The Devil's Mark; 6 Imps; 7 The Swimming Test; 8 Scratching; 9 Supernatural Evidentiary Techniques as Experiments; 10 Judicial Assessment of Narratives and Statements; 11 Searching for Reliable Testimony; 12 Confession; Conclusions; Bibliography; Index of Names; Subject Index. - Exploring the crime of witchcraft in early modern England, this book focuses on legal questions of proof. As a capital crime - yet one that was uniquely difficult to prove - witchcraft investigations and trials offer a fascinating lens through which to observe social and judicial attitudes towards crime, punishment and evidentiary standards.
